Как устроены серверные операционные системы
Серверные операционные системы составляют собой профильное программное обеспечение для управления аппаратными средствами компьютера. Архитектура таких систем выстраивается на принципе многозадачности и многопользовательского доступа. Ядро организует деятельность процессора, оперативной памяти, дисковых хранилищ и сетевых интерфейсов.
Фундамент образует модульная организация, где каждый блок исполняет определенные функции. Драйверы гарантируют связь с реальным устройствами. Планировщик задач распределяет вычислительные возможности между потоками. Файловая система структурирует размещение данных на хранилищах.
Серверная вавада содержит службы для обслуживания сетевых запросов и запуска сервисов. Системные библиотеки обеспечивают приложениям готовые функции для операций с ресурсами. Механизмы изоляции задач устраняют столкновения между программами.
Интерфейс командной строки обеспечивает администраторам настраивать установки и мониторить положение системы. Записи событий регистрируют данные о деятельности блоков vavada казино. Такая организация гарантирует стабильную деятельность аппаратуры под большой нагрузкой.
Чем серверная ОС разнится от обычной
Ключевое отличие заключается в цели и способе эксплуатации. Настольные системы нацелены на функционирование одного юзера с графическими программами. Серверные платформы обрабатывают массу concurrent коннектов и исполняют фоновые операции без вмешательства человека.
Графический интерфейс в серверных версиях зачастую недоступен или упрощен. Управление осуществляется через командную строку и настроечные файлы. Такой метод минимизирует использование средств и увеличивает быстродействие. Десктопные редакции предлагают графические утилиты для ежедневных задач.
Серверные решения предоставляют улучшенные опции увеличения. Системы vavada работают с значительными количествами памяти и набором процессорных ядер. Надежность и непрерывность работы крайне значимы для серверного программного обеспечения. Системы конструируются для круглосуточного функционирования без перезапусков. Системы дублирования защищают от отказов. Настольные редакции позволяют периодические рестарты и менее взыскательны к надежности.
Основные задания серверных систем
Серверные платформы выполняют набор функций по предоставлению деятельности сетевых услуг и программ:
- Выполнение входящих сетевых подключений и перенаправление трафика.
- Активация и контроль работы пользовательских приложений и веб-сервисов.
- Распределение вычислительной ресурсов между активными задачами.
- Наблюдение положения физических блоков и системных блоков.
- Ведение записей событий для анализа быстродействия.
Программное обеспечение организует связь между клиентными устройствами и расчетными возможностями. Архитектура позволяет синхронно осуществлять тысячи обращений от различных пользователей.
Размещение и управление данными образует центральную цель серверных платформ. Файловые накопители организуют обращение к файлам, медиафайлам и архивам. Системы управления базами данных осуществляют организованную сведения. Механизмы архивного дублирования оберегают ценные информацию от потери.
Система обеспечивает разделение клиентских контекстов и программ. Виртуализация обеспечивает инициализировать множество изолированных казино вавада на одном физическом узле. Распределение нагруженности выделяет задания между доступными средствами для максимальной эффективности.
Как выполняются обращения пользователей
Процесс обработки начинается с приема обращения через сетевой интерфейс. Приходящее коннект помещается в список, где дожидается своей очереди. Сетевой стек анализирует пакеты сведений и определяет требуемый модуль. Диспетчер передает запрос соответствующему софтверному компоненту.
Сервис принимает сведения и производит требуемые действия. Утилита может обратиться к файловой системе для считывания или сохранения информации. База данных отдает искомые строки. Расчетные действия выполняются процессором соответственно приоритету задачи.
Многопотоковая организация дает выполнять множество обращений одновременно. Каждое соединение приобретает отдельный нить выполнения. Планировщик делит процессорное время между активными задачами. Серверная вавада отслеживает использование памяти и пресекает перегрузку средств.
Подготовленный ответ передается обратно клиенту через сетевое соединение. Протоколы транспортного уровня обеспечивают доставку данных. Протокол регистрирует данные о совершенной действии и положении выполнения. Освобожденные возможности оказываются доступными для последующих обращений.
Управление ресурсами и нагрузкой
Эффективное распределение средств обеспечивает стабильную работу всех модулей. Диспетчер операций назначает первоочередности потоков и распределяет вычислительное время. Алгоритмы выравнивания исключают переполнение индивидуальных элементов. Мониторинг фиксирует актуальное статус аппаратуры в настоящем времени.
Оперативная память разносится между работающими программами адаптивно. Средство свопинга применяет файловое объем при дефиците реальной памяти. Кэширование увеличивает доступ к регулярно используемым данным. Автоматизированная очистка высвобождает пустующие области памяти.
Дисковые операции улучшаются через очереди запросов и упреждающее считывание. Файловая система группирует ассоциированные сведения для минимизации времени доступа. Серверные vavada допускают живую смену хранилищ без прекращения функционирования.
Сетевая модуль отслеживает передающую способность магистралей связи. Регулирование пропускной способности пресекает узурпацию bandwidth отдельными соединениями. Классификация трафика гарантирует стандарт работы важных сервисов. Статистика загрузки помогает проектировать развитие архитектуры.
Защита и управление подключения
Защита данных и ресурсов базируется на многослойной модели разграничения привилегий. Каждый оператор приобретает уникальный ID и набор полномочий. Аутентификация верифицирует достоверность регистрационных профилей при входе. Пароли содержатся в зашифрованном виде для предотвращения неавторизованного подключения.
Разрешения доступа к данным и папкам устанавливаются отдельно для каждого объекта. Хозяин элемента устанавливает разрешенные процедуры для прочих пользователей. Коллективы собирают учетные профили с идентичными привилегиями. Серверная казино вавада останавливает попытки выполнения запрещенных действий.
Межсетевой экран отсеивает входящий и отправляемый поток по заданным критериям. Реестры управления лимитируют соединения с конкретных IP-адресов. Системы выявления вторжений исследуют странную деятельность. Криптование предохраняет транспортируемую данные от захвата.
Протоколы безопасности записывают все действия доступа к закрытым объектам. Контроль событий способствует обнаружить нарушения правил. Автоматизированные оповещения информируют управляющих о важных событиях. Периодическое актуализация критериев приспосабливает платформу к актуальным угрозам.
Деятельность с сетью и коннектами
Сетевая модуль предоставляет коммуникацию сервера с внешними машинами и иными машинами. Сетевые интерфейсы получают и передают информацию по разным протоколам. Драйверы адаптеров контролируют материальными портами. Установка IP-адресов задает идентификацию узла в сети.
Набор протоколов TCP/IP осуществляет пересылку данных на различных уровнях. Маршрутизация передает пакеты к конечным точкам через наилучшие пути. DNS-резолвер конвертирует доменные имена в числовые идентификаторы. DHCP автоматически выделяет сетевые конфигурации присоединенным терминалам.
Регулирование соединениями охватывает контроль активных подключений и таймаутов. Пулы соединений вторично задействуют открытые соединения для экономии возможностей. Серверные вавада поддерживают тысячи параллельных TCP-соединений за счет эффективным схемам. Балансировщики выделяют приходящий поток между разными серверами.
Мониторинг сетевой деятельности контролирует передающую способность и отклики. Тестовые программы контролируют доступность дистанционных хостов. Аналитика портов отображает размеры переданных информации и число отказов. Настройка кэшей повышает производительность при различных видах загрузки.
Актуализации и обслуживание решения
Периодическое апдейт программного обеспечения предоставляет защищенность и бесперебойность деятельности. Создатели издают патчи для закрытия слабостей и багов. Системы пакетов автоматизируют скачивание и развертывание патчей. Управляющие намечают применение модификаций в промежутки минимальной нагрузки.
Проверка апдейтов на отдельных площадках пресекает внезапные ошибки. Backup дублирование параметров обеспечивает скоро откатить корректировки при сбоях. Серверная vavada поддерживает системы отката к прошлым версиям блоков.
Контроль статуса проверяет наличие свежих редакций приложений и модулей. Алерты оповещают о приоритетных апдейтах защиты. Автоматизированные тесты определяют deprecated блоки. Регламенты обновления определяют приоритеты и сроки применения изменений.
Техническая обслуживание вендоров предоставляет консультации по конфигурации и решению сбоев. Объединение клиентов делится знаниями выполнения задач. Репозитории знаний хранят руководства по управлению. Платные договоры гарантируют получение апдейтов в течение конкретного периода.
Где задействуются серверные операционные системы
Веб-хостинг представляет одну из главных направлений эксплуатации серверных платформ. Фирмы размещают ресурсы и веб-приложения на выделенных или виртуальных машинах. Системы осуществляют HTTP-запросы от миллионов юзеров постоянно.
Предприятийные сети строятся на серверную инфраструктуру для хранения сведений и активации бизнес-приложений. Файловые серверы предоставляют централизованный обращение к материалам. Почтовые системы выполняют коммуникацию организации. Базы данных включают информацию о покупателях и денежных операциях.
Облачные провайдеры выстраивают расширяемые решения на фундаменте серверных платформ. Виртуализация дает формировать отдельные контексты для множественных пользователей. Серверные казино вавада гарантируют масштабируемость и эффективность облачных услуг.
Научные операции требуют высокопроизводительных серверных кластеров для выполнения огромных массивов сведений. Исследовательские центры эмулируют сложные операции. Медицинские учреждения сохраняют цифровые записи пациентов на охраняемых хостах. Образовательные системы обеспечивают доступ к образовательным ресурсам.